Ferrari
Tammy and I went to see Ferrari tonight. When I saw the preview for this movie we had just been to Italy and visited the Ferrari museums. In the movie there were a few scenes that were definitely shot in Modena and were places that we had been.
The movie was great. The retelling of the Mille Miglia and the horrific crash that killed so many spectators and ended the race was rough. You certainly leave with an appreciation of how dangerous motor racing was back in the early days.
